Vienna Airport
I arrived at Vienna Airport at about 8 o'clock by car and immediately walked to the check-in counter. As there were only two Economy counters and online check-in was not possible for this flight, there was a long line and I had to wait about 45 minutes. After check-in I proceeded to security.

After clearing security in about 5 minutes, I walked to the gate for the flight, C40. My aircraft was just arriving.

At 9:35, boarding began and priorities were respected.

Legroom enough for me (1.65m/5.4feet) but not very generous.

At 10:06, boarding was completed and the captain welcomed us on board. Afterwards, a manual safety demonstration started and we were pushed back.
Taxiing to the runway.



At 10:29, we took off with a delay of 24 minutes.




Shortly afterwards, the seat belt signs were turned off and the curtain to business class was closed.

At 10:45, meal service started. First, drinks were offered. I took a cup of water. Then, snacks (salty (french cookie) or salty (sticks with salt) ) were distributed.


Afterwards, I visited the rear lavatory. It was clean, but rather small.

At 11:46 we started our descent to Paris.



Landing at 12:03, 7 minutes early.


We arrived at Terminal 2F.

Charles de Gaulle Airport
Walking towards luggage claim. The luggage arrived at belt 26. Interestingly, my luggage, even though Priority-Tagged, arrived later than a lot of other bags not equipped with this tag. However, this was no problem, as I had many hours between my connection, anyway.





As my connecting flight departed from Orly, I had to take the bus (le bus direct) line 3.
